在当今的开发环境中,GitHub 已成为开源项目托管和版本控制的重要平台。为了提高安全性和便捷性,GitHub 提供了各种应用程序(app)以辅助用户进行登录和管理操作。本文将详细介绍 GitHub 登录用的应用程序的功能、使用方法以及常见问题解答。
GitHub 登录用的应用程序概述
GitHub 登录的应用程序是指那些帮助用户在 GitHub 上进行身份验证和授权的工具。这些应用程序通常包括:
- 移动应用:如 GitHub 的官方移动客户端
- 桌面客户端:如 GitHub Desktop
- 第三方应用:一些集成了 GitHub 功能的工具或服务
通过这些应用程序,用户可以更加安全和高效地访问其 GitHub 账户,尤其是在多设备使用的场景下。
GitHub 移动应用的功能
GitHub 的官方移动应用提供了多种实用功能,包括:
- 查看和管理代码库:用户可以随时随地查看项目、拉取请求、问题跟踪等。
- 代码审查:支持在线审查拉取请求,并添加评论。
- 接收通知:及时接收项目动态通知,让团队协作更高效。
- 支持 SSH 和 HTTPS:可以安全地管理和操作代码。
GitHub 桌面客户端的功能
GitHub Desktop 是一个强大的桌面应用程序,具有以下主要功能:
- 版本控制:直观的界面使得用户可以轻松管理版本和提交记录。
- 拖拽功能:可以通过拖拽将文件直接添加到仓库中。
- 同步功能:自动同步本地更改与 GitHub 上的项目。
- 支持多种分支管理:便于进行多版本开发。
如何使用 GitHub 登录的应用程序
登录 GitHub 移动应用
- 下载并安装 GitHub 移动应用。
- 打开应用程序后,选择“登录”。
- 输入你的 GitHub 用户名和密码。
- 按照提示完成双重身份验证(如适用)。
- 成功登录后,你就可以访问你的仓库和项目。
登录 GitHub 桌面客户端
- 下载并安装 GitHub Desktop。
- 启动程序后,选择“登录”。
- 使用你的 GitHub 账户信息进行登录。
- 按照提示完成双重身份验证(如适用)。
- 进入主界面后,可以开始管理你的项目。
GitHub 第三方应用
许多第三方应用也支持 GitHub 登录,例如 CI/CD 工具、项目管理软件等。使用这些应用时,通常可以通过 OAuth 2.0 授权来实现对 GitHub 账户的安全访问。这些应用往往提供额外的功能,进一步增强了开发和协作的体验。
常见的第三方应用
- Travis CI:持续集成服务,可以与 GitHub 进行无缝集成。
- Slack:通过集成 GitHub 通知,增强团队沟通。
- Trello:支持与 GitHub 项目关联,便于任务管理。
常见问题解答
GitHub 登录用的应用程序安全吗?
是的,GitHub 提供的官方应用程序是安全的,并采用了多层次的安全措施,包括双重身份验证、加密等。此外,许多第三方应用也遵循安全标准,确保用户的账户信息安全。
如何恢复被锁定的 GitHub 账户?
如果账户因多次登录失败被锁定,用户可以通过注册邮箱请求重置密码,或联系 GitHub 支持寻求帮助。
如何确保我使用的 GitHub 应用程序是官方的?
确保在 GitHub 的官方网站或可信的应用商店下载应用程序,避免使用不明来源的链接。
GitHub 应用程序的支持功能有哪些?
应用程序通常提供的支持功能包括:技术支持、用户文档、社区支持等,确保用户在使用中遇到的问题能够得到及时解决。
可以在多个设备上登录 GitHub 吗?
可以,GitHub 支持在多个设备上同时登录,用户只需输入正确的账户信息即可。同时使用时需要注意账户安全,建议开启双重身份验证。
总结
总之,GitHub 登录用的应用程序为开发者提供了更加便捷和安全的访问方式。无论是官方移动应用还是桌面客户端,都大大提高了开发效率和协作体验。希望通过本文的介绍,能帮助你更好地理解和使用 GitHub 登录的应用程序。

